We have 2 IIS Servers running on Server 2016 with shared configuration. I will mention "Server A" and "Server B" after this. We are using DFS for sync to the configurations. IIS configurations are locating some folder under C: drive. We are using this topology for many years. Nowadays we have problem. Whenever I change any configuration like site binding or new sub application on Server A, DFS will working fine, I can see the change inside the applicationHost.config file on Server B, but IIS service on Server B does not realize the change until i restart the app. Same thing exist both servers. Any change on Server B does not reflect Server A although I see the change inside the applicationHost.config file. This situation started after I did up to date the servers. I tried uninstall the updates but some updates cannot be uninstalled. I tested this situation on Server 2016 and Server 2019 on my test environment. When i build topology without any windows update, they are working fine. But after windows update, problem begins. On 2016 IIS servers, there are 3 windows update packages. KB4537764, KB4520724 and KB4049065. As i dig, there are no reported bugs about this situation.

So, do you have any solution or fix related to this problem?
